CAUTION:

There is a danger of a new battery exploding if it is incorrectly installed. Replace the battery only with the same or equivalent type

recommended by the manufacturer. Discard used batteries according to the manufacturer's instructions.

CAUTION:

Before you begin any of the procedures in this section, follow the safety instructions located in the Product Information Guide.

 

Replace the battery  —

 

If you have to repeatedly reset time and date information after turning on the computer, or if an incorrect time or

date displays during start-up,

replace the battery

. If the battery still does not work properly,

contact Dell

.

Test the drive  —

 

l

 

Insert another floppy disk, CD, or DVD to eliminate the possibility that the original one is defective.

l

 

Insert a bootable floppy disk and restart the computer.

NOTE:

Because of different regions worldwide and different disc formats, not all DVD titles work in all DVD drives.
